Dažna klaida:
Learners sometimes confuse 'suppose' with 'guess'. 'Guess' can be more about making a quick, less certain answer, while 'suppose' can show a thoughtful assumption.

Dažna klaida:
Learners sometimes omit 'be' and say 'I supposed to go' instead of 'I am supposed to go'. The auxiliary verb is necessary.

Sinonimai
should ('Should' expresses duty or advisability; 'be supposed to' emphasizes expectation based on rules or arrangements.)
